https://www.guru3d.com/news-story/razer-basilisk-ultimate-and-razer-basilisk-x-hyperspeed-mice.html Razer today announced the launch of the Razer Basilisk Ultimate and the Razer Basilisk X HyperSpeed gaming mice. Both are joining Razer's ever-advancing wireless mouse family and offer the best-in-class wireless technology with Razer HyperSpeed.
ABOUT THE RAZER BASILISK ULTIMATE
- True 20,000 DPI Focus+ optical sensor with 99.6% resolution accuracy
- Up to 650 inches per second (IPS) / 50 G acceleration
- Advanced Lift-off/Landing distance customization
- HyperSpeed wireless technology
- Eleven independently programmable buttons
- Replaceable Multi-function paddle
- Razer Optical Mouse Switches rated for 70 M clicks
- Ergonomic right-handed design with textured side-grips
- Gaming-grade tactile scroll wheel with infinitely customizable resistance
- On-The-Fly Sensitivity Adjustment (Default stages: 800/1800/4000/9000/20000)
- Hybrid On-board and Cloud Storage (4+1 profiles)
- Razer Synapse 3 enabled
- 14 Razer Chroma RGB lighting zones with true 16.8 million customizable color options
- Inter-device color synchronization
- Wired and Wireless usage modes.
- 4 GHz dongle
- 8 m / 6 ft Speedflex cable for charging and wired use
- Razer Mouse charging dock compatible
- Battery life: Approximately 100 hours (without lighting) (Battery life depends on usage settings)
- Approximate size: 130 mm / 5.11 in (Length) x 75 mm / 2.75 in (Width) x 42 mm / 1.65 in (Height)
- Approximate weight: 107 g / 3.77 oz (Excluding cable)
